Summary of the Inventive Concept

The inventive concept relates to specialized orthopaedic bone stabilisation devices adapted for specific, narrow market or unique operational environments, including extreme weather conditions, disaster relief situations, high-security needs, high-altitude environments, and emergency response scenarios.

Background and Problem Solved

The original patent disclosed an orthopaedic bone stabilisation device for general use. However, certain environments require tailored solutions to address specific challenges. For instance, extreme weather conditions demand corrosion-resistant coatings and temperature-resistant materials, while disaster relief situations necessitate integrated sensors for real-time feedback. The inventive concept addresses these limitations by providing specialized variations of the original device.

Detailed Description of the Inventive Concept

The inventive concept encompasses five specialized variations of the original orthopaedic bone stabilisation device: (1) a corrosion-resistant device for extreme weather conditions, featuring a temperature-resistant material and adapted to withstand temperatures ranging from -40°C to 50°C; (2) a device with an integrated sensor for monitoring bone healing in disaster relief situations, providing real-time feedback to medical professionals; (3) a high-security device for correctional facilities, incorporating a tamper-evident feature and restricted access mechanism; (4) a lightweight yet strong device for high-altitude environments, featuring a specialized thread design for optimal grip in low-oxygen conditions; and (5) a portable kit for emergency responders, comprising a compact carrying case and pre-assembled device with an easy-to-use deployment mechanism.
